Microsoft Unveils Child-friendly Net Browser
The 'Click Clever, Click Safe' browser is a protection tool for youngsters from a host of cyber threats.

To protect children from viewing inappropriate content and from the even greater danger of online paedophilia, Microsoft has launched an enhanced version of Internet Explorer 8. Called the 'Click Clever, Click Safe' browser, it will empower youngsters-and families with a one-click tool to report offensive content or the threat of cyber bullying to the authorities. The Internet giant said it developed the tool in collaboration with Ceop, the Child Exploitation and Online Protection Centre, reports The Telegraph.
It is estimated that almost two-thirds of under-18s in the UK have been contacted online by strangers. More than a third responded to the person's overtures.
41 per cent of parents were unaware whether their children had updated their privacy settings on their social networking profile. More than half the youngsters questioned said their parents did not monitor their online activities.
